Signs and symptoms of inflammatory myositis, ANA 1:40 is found in 20 30% of healthy people, ANA 1:80 is found in 10 15% of healthy people, ANA 1:160 is found in 5% of healthy people, ANA 1:320 is found in 3% of healthy people, 5 25% of healthy people with a family member suffering from lupus have a positive ANA, Up to 70% of people aged above 70 years have a positive ANA. @johnbishop Hmmm, well I guess it makes sense that they dont know what makes it come out of remission. an ANA titer of 1:640 is defined as a "high titer" because of a 0.5% prevalence of positives in normal individuals. The IF ANA is generally screened at a dilution (e.g., titer) of 1:40, and, if positive, serial dilutions are carried out until a dilution is negative. In our laboratory, an ANA titer of 1:640 is defined as a high titer because of a 0.5% prevalence of positives in normal individuals. In simplest terms, ANA-negative lupus is a condition in which a person's ANA (antinuclear antibody) immunofluorescence (IF) test comes back negative, but the person exhibits traits consistent with someone diagnosed with syst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E; also called lupus). Oligoarticular juvenile chronic arthritis, Thyroid diseases (Hashimoto thyroiditis, Grave disease), Gastrointestinal diseases (autoimmune hepatitis, primary biliary cholangitis [also known as primary biliary cirrhosis], inflammatory bowel disease), Pulmonary diseases (id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is), Viral infections (hepatitis C, parvovirus), As a harbinger of the future development of autoimmune disease, Various medications, without causing an autoimmune disease, Having one or more relatives with an autoimmune disease.
